Apply domain separation on dot walked fields [Updated in Security Center 1.3 and 1.5]
The glide.sys.domain.include_domain_condition_on_join property controls whether join queries are given domain separated conditions or not in order to ensure they apply domain separation functionality for dot walked fields.

Warning:
This is a safe harbor property, meaning the value can't be altered once it's changed. It is non-revertible.
More information
| Attribute | Description |
|---|---|
| Property name | glide.sys.domain.include_domain_condition_on_join |
| Configuration type | System Properties (/sys_properties_list.do) |
| Data type | boolean |
| Recommended value | True, when domain separation is installed, otherwise the property won't exist. |
| Default value | false |
| Category | Access control |
| Purpose | Controls whether join queries are given domain separated conditions or not, in order to ensure they apply domain separation functionality for dot walked fields. |
